  • The value of acceleration due to gravity on Earth is approximately: A. 8.9 m/s² B. 10 m/s² C. 9.8 m/s² D. 9.2 m/s²
    Answer: C
  • Which of the following will experience the least pressure? A. A person standing on high heels B. An elephant standing on four legs C. A person lying flat on the floor D. A person standing on his head
    Answer: C

  • A force of 200 N is applied on an area of 2 m². What is the pressure? A. 50 Pa B. 100 Pa C. 200 Pa D. 400 Pa
    Answer: B
  • If a body is in free fall, which force is acting on it? A. Frictional force B. Applied force C. Air resistance D. Gravitational force
    Answer D
  • Which of the following organisms belongs to the kingdom Monera? A. Amoeba B. Bacteria C. Mushroom D. Paramecium
    Answer: B
  • Which kingdom includes multicellular, autotrophic organisms with chlorophyll? A. Animalia B. Plantae C. Fungi D. Protista
    Answer B
  • What is the basis for classification in the five-kingdom system? A. Habitat B. Food habits C. Cell structure and body organization D. Number of legs
    Answer C
  • Two objects of mass 5 kg and 10 kg are dropped from the same height in a vacuum. Which will hit the ground first? A. 5 kg object B. 10 kg object C. Both at the same time D. None will hit the ground
    Answer: C
  • What is the SI unit of the universal gravitational constant (G)? A. N/kg B. N·m²/kg² C. m/s² D. N·kg²/m²
    Answer: B
  • Which of the following best explains why objects fall to the ground? A. Air pressure B. Earth's magnetism C. Gravitational force D. Inertia
    Answer: C
  • Why do camels have large flat feet? A. To walk slowly B. To reduce pressure on sand C. To store fat D. To balance body temperature
    Answer: B
  • A pressure of 500 Pa is applied on an area of 0.2 m². What is the force?A. 10 N B. 50 N C. 100 N D. 200 N
    Answer: C

  • Pressure is defined as: A. Force × Area B. Force / Area C. Mass / Volume D. Weight × Height
    Answer: B
  • What happens to the gravitational force between two objects if the distance between them is doubled? A. It doubles B. It becomes one-fourth C. It remains unchanged D. It becomes four times
    Answer: B
  • Which of the following is correct during free fall near the Earth’s surface (ignoring air resistance)? A. Acceleration is zero B. Acceleration is 9.8 m/s² downward C. Speed remains constant D. Only vertical velocity changes
    Answer: B
  • Which of the following instruments is used to measure atmospheric pressure? A. Manometer B. Barometer C. Thermometer D. Hygrometer
    Answer: B
